ICT NETWORK MANAGER - SEN SCHOOL

 

 

JOB TITLE: ICT Systems & Network Manager

LOCATION: London

 

TYPE: Permanent/Full Time Managed Services

 

SALARY : £30k-£35k (based on experience)

 

REPORTING TO: Joskos Service Delivery Manager

 

CLOSING DATE: 10th June 2014

 

 

PURPOSE

Introduction:-

We are looking for an experienced and enthusiastic person to lead, manage and support all technical aspects of curriculum and administrative ICT within the school, keeping the school at the forefront of ICT. The school caters for children with complex needs, so this candidate will need be compassionate to the needs of these special kids.

 

To support learning by:-

 

  1. Playing a key role in the strategic leadership of ICT throughout the school, reporting to and liaising with Joskos and school management.
  2. Developing and implementing a shared vision with school management as to how ICT resources can enhance both teaching and learning and management activities.
  3. Management of all network, server and wireless infrastructure upgrade projects in line with Joskos methodology.
  4. Managing the school’s ICT systems, services and resources and ensure the integrity of all school data.
  5. Liaise with Joskos ICT Consultants to ensure the school keeps up to date with changes in technology and investigate how these technologies might be used to support learning.

MAIN D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ES

Systems and Services

 

  1. To manage, develop and document the curriculum and administrative ICT systems within the school: servers, hardware, operating systems, network infrastructure and software applications.
  2. To have knowledge and understanding of Health & Safety, software; licensing, data protection and other legislation that relates to ICT.
  3. To test and evaluate new ICT systems (software and hardware) and make product recommendations to school management in line with Joskos ICT strategies.
  4. To co-ordinate the configuration of new and existing hardware and software.
  5. To co-ordinate the regular and systematic routine maintenance of servers, workstations and network infrastructure so as to maximise their life expectancy, functionality, security and ensure Health and Safety standards are met.
  6. To ensure the regular & systematic backup of data and recovery of systems data.
  7. To ensure that the school’s computer networks are secure and protected.
  8. To investigate reported faults, maintain records of faults and the undertaking of minor repair work where appropriate or operate agreed procedures should third party repair be required.
  9. To manage Internet and email provision.
  10. In conjunction with the MIS Service Provider, ensure that the school's MIS system is operating securely and efficiently.
  11. To assist in the development of the school’s managed learning environment, intranet and website, ensuring information is updated effectively and overseeing the technical management of these systems.
  12. To be responsible for the administration and maintenance of Digital Signage systems.
  13. To manage the maintenance and installation of all interactive whiteboard systems within the school and associated hardware and services.
  14. To ensure that the school’s hardware and software comply with relevant legislation and regulations.
  15. To ensure the operating systems installed are protected through the use of suitable anti-virus software and operating system patches.
  16. To provide training and support in the effective use of relevant hardware and software in use within the school.

 

Resources

 

  1. To draw up plans and specifications for the purchase of computing equipment and software and to design and specify what is practically possible and affordable within the school’s current and future ICT development plans, ensuring best value.
  2. To ensure that all ICT assets are appropriately recorded and accounted for on the asset register including software licences and all tangible assets are security marked.
  3. To oversee the installation of all computing and networking equipment.

 

External liaison and Work scheduling:

 

  1. Liaise with Joskos and other 3rd party companies for works relating to ICT, ensuring technical specifications are compiled.
  2. Manage and direct actions and work of suppliers relating to ICT and/or associated works inside and outside warranty periods.
  3. In conjunction with school management, sensitively and logically schedule all ICT associated work to ensure minimum disruption to network services.
  4. Ensuring the work of all external providers is carried out to an agreed high standard.

 

Leadership and Management

 

  1. To provide strategic advice on the management of ICT across the school and ensuring that structures and resources meet the school’s curriculum and administration needs.
  2. To operationally manage the ICT Technician, prioritising and overseeing his work on a daily basis to meet long term strategic objectives.
  3. To develop, implement and maintain the school’s ICT policy and procedures in consultation with Joskos and school management.
  4. To liaise with Joskos for the procurement of all ICT hardware and software for the school, ensuring compliance with the School’s Finance Policy.
  5. Keeping a log of all technical faults via the Joskos Service Desk system already in place.
